Telecommunications Gemini Comm bags BSNL order New Delhi, Sept. 21 The Chennai-based Gemini Communication Ltd has bagged a contract from the State-owned Bharat Sanchar Nigam Ltd for installation and commissioning of telecom equipment and their connected accessories across 11 telecom circles in the country for CDMA connectivity. The contract is valued at Rs 10 crore. The circles are Andaman & Nicobar, Andhra Pradesh, Chhattisgarh, Gujarat, Himachal Pradesh, Jammu and Kashmir, Karnataka, Madhya Pradesh, Punjab, Rajasthan and Kerala, acc ording to a company release. The CDMA deployment is being undertaken to improve connectivity and clarity for BSNL subscribers and is scheduled to be completed by next month, the release added. Commenting on the development, the Executive Director, Mr Ram Kumar, said that Gemini Communication was entering into the area of cellular communication from the hitherto stronghold of broadband access. “With this contract, it will deploy skilled manpower, installation tools, aids and measuring instruments in all the circles for expediting the work,” he said. — Our Bureau More Stories on : Telecommunications | New Business
